    HS4 Beta 4.2.13.0 coming soon

    4.2.12.8 (4.2.13.0 Beta) has been posted:
    HS4 Beta 4.2.12.8 is available for testing! - HomeSeer Message Board

    Here is the current list of issues/features for the 4.2.13.0 release of HS4. I am posting it so you can see what is coming. Note that there is no guarantee that all of these issues will be in the next update.
    HS-1616 Linked devices list in device properties does not show all available devices
    HS-1615 Z-Wave tab is missing device name
    HS-1607 Create event action to enable or disable selected events or event groups
    HS-1598 C# scripting fix errors with the using statement, allow support for //css_ directives
    HS-1585 Add support for TLS 1.2, update email support
    HS-1573 When an event runs an other event, an option is needed to run them in order or parallel
    HS-1567 Add a spinner to pages that refresh the page
    HS-1565 If a slash or double quote is in the device filter, it cannot be removed
    HS-1525 Add Buttons to All Camera Page
    HS-1441 When clicking on a device name in grid view, the status in the pop up does not update
    HS-1433 When setting Hide From Views on a root device, all the features are also hidden
    HS-1432 Searching for tags does not work as expected
    HS-1380 Add a "Time Frame" condition to HS4 events.
    HS-1345 Apostrophes in phrases break the speak event action on Pi hubs
    HS-1315 System keeps logging message "unable to perform cloud backup as subscripting information is not available"
    HS-1230 Unable to download backups when connecting via MyHS
    HS-401 Modify the events page to not refresh the entire page on edits
